Best Equestrian Camping near Selma, OR
Sam Brown Campground offers primitive equestrian camping in a peaceful environment near Selma, Oregon. The horse camp area provides space for riders and their horses, though users note it is getting somewhat run down. The campground has toilet facilities but lacks amenities like drinking water, hookups, showers, or trash service. Campers must pack out all waste. The campground accommodates both tent and RV camping with ample parking for horse trailers. Each site includes a picnic table and fire ring, allowing fires when seasonal restrictions permit.
Briggs Creek runs year-round through the campground, providing water access for horses. The surrounding trail system offers excellent riding opportunities with multiple routes suitable for various skill levels. Located about 3 miles from the nearest cell service area, the campground provides a true disconnect from urban environments. The trails are consistently rated as "amazing" by visitors who return annually with their horses. Seasonal considerations include potential closures during winter months, though the campground is technically open year-round. Campers should prepare for completely self-sufficient camping as no drinking water is available on site, and facilities remain primitive throughout the camping area.
